The evaluation process for children with feeding problems should include an interdisciplinary approach with a medical, nutritional, occupational therapy, and behavioral evaluation. swallowing, learning new techniques for feeding, and determining which foods and liquids are most appropriate for your child and which should be avoided Evaluates and treats patients with swallowing difficulties, including direct modifications of physiologic responses and indirect approaches such as diet modification. The Practice of Occupational Therapy in Feeding, Eating, and Swallowing Feeding, eating, and swallowing are valued occupations across the lifespan—activities of daily living (ADLs) that are “fundamental to living in a social world; they enable basic survival and well-being” (Christiansen & Hammecker, 2001, p. 156).
